How to Get to Wattville

Transport Hub

Wattville Taxi Rank (Dube Street)

Taxi Cost

R12–R15

Landmark

Unilever (Boksburg) (Main security gate on Peter Road); Macsteel (Main entrance off Main Reef Road); Benoni South Manufacturing Plants (Factories along Reading Road)

Getting to work from Wattville is straightforward, mainly by taxi. The Wattville Taxi Rank on Dube Street is your main departure point. Taxis to Benoni CBD cost R12–R15 and take 10–15 minutes, while Boksburg CBD is R16–R22, taking 20–30 minutes. For early shifts, aim to be at the rank by 5:00 AM. While trains from Benoni South station are an option, taxis are generally more direct for reaching specific factory gates.

From Wattville Taxi Rank (Dube Street), taxis can drop you directly at the main employment nodes. For Benoni South Manufacturing Plants, ask for factories along Reading Road. For Macsteel, you'll want the main entrance off Main Reef Road. If heading to Unilever in Boksburg, taxis will get you close to the main security gate on Peter Road, a short walk away.

Working Hours

Driver shifts around Wattville typically start early, often before 6 AM, to beat traffic and meet delivery deadlines. Most roles are day shifts, running 8-10 hours, five to six days a week. Some logistics companies might require evening or occasional night shifts for long-haul or urgent deliveries, especially in the warehousing sector.

Salary Range

R8,000 – R15,000 per month

The R8,000–R15,000/mo salary range for Drivers in Wattville, based on ShiftMate placement data, shows good potential. Your earnings will depend on factors like the type of vehicle you drive (LDV vs. heavier truck), the industry (FMCG often pays more than smaller logistics firms), and your experience. More years behind the wheel and a spotless record can push you to the higher end. Remember, the national minimum wage is set at R28.79 per hour in 2026, so your pay will always be above this baseline.

A Driver in Wattville can expect competitive pay within Ekurhuleni. While slightly below the average for central Ekurhuleni (R9,500–R17,000), Wattville's rates are solid. Nationally, specialized driving roles might earn more, but for general driving, Wattville offers a fair wage.

Safety Tips for Wattville

While Wattville is close to industrial zones, be cautious. Crossing busy Reading Road and the railway lines on foot can be dangerous, especially during peak hours. After dark, mugging hotspots exist along the industrial borders. Always walk in large groups when returning from Benoni South after a late shift, and stay aware of your surroundings.

Job Market in Wattville

Wattville's economy thrives on heavy manufacturing, steel processing, and FMCG distribution, largely thanks to its proximity to Benoni South and Dunswart. These industries create consistent, high demand for Drivers to transport raw materials, move products between factory stages, and deliver finished goods. This means a steady stream of job opportunities for anyone with a valid driver's license and a good work ethic.

Where to Eat Near Work

Lunch options are plentiful and budget-friendly for Drivers in Wattville. A short walk to Benoni South industrial areas gives you access to numerous food caravans, where a massive portion of pap, chakalaka, and wors costs around R45. Closer to home in Wattville, local gwinya (vetkoek) vendors sell delicious breakfast or lunch for under R20, perfect for a quick, affordable bite.
